colour correction between different camera clips in multicam edits

hi there,


i have recordings of sony and cvc cameras to be edited in multicam edit in fcp. are there any suggestions, best practices or readymade effects that will be useful?


sample clips can be provided.


sony clips see to be colour corrected and jvc clips are blend.

I got the files. Match Color doesn't work on this. The JVC seems quite cold to me. I used the Balance Color function and used the white of his suit in the JVC front shot. That seemed like a good starting point and pulled it closer to the Sony. (A bit odd as I usually find Sonys have a colder look.) As Ben said use the Color Wheels to balance the color. You can afford to push the overall luma up quite a lot. They shouldn't be too hard to tweak.
